Alabama-Florida State football game already sold out
The highly anticipated college football season opener between Alabama and Florida State is already sold out, Chick-fil-A Kickoff Game ticket offices announced on Friday. The Sept. 2 game is being played at Atlanta’s new 75,000-seat Mercedes-Benz Stadium.
Based on StubHub ticket prices, Alabama-Florida State upper-deck tickets are ranging between $400 and $500, which means the game is poised to be the second-most-expensive ticket for the 2017 season, with Georgia-Notre Dame tickets running for $545 apiece.
The Week 1 showdown between the powerhouse programs won’t lack any buzz, pitting the nation’s likely top two teams against each other.
“Florida State has a great team and a great program and will probably be No. 1 in the country,” Alabama coach Nick Saban said in May about the Seminoles, even though his Crimson Tide will likely be the preseason No. 1 in most polls.
Bama welcomes another class of five-star freshmen and now has an experienced quarterback and Heisman candidate in Jalen Hurts.
